Job Overview:

  • The Electrical Engineer is responsible for overseeing the design and engineering of Liquids Pump Station facilities for capital expansion and maintenance projects executed by third-party engineering consultants. This role ensures that all designs comply with corporate standards, regulatory requirements, and applicable industry codes while meeting project budget and schedule objectives.
  • The position serves as a key liaison with other Enbridge functional groups within Project Execution, Operations, Shared Services, and construction teams, as well as external engineering firms, to ensure project requirements are effectively incorporated into design deliverables and successfully implemented throughout the project lifecycle.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age and coordinate third-party engineering consultants to ensure design deliverables are completed on schedule, within budget, and in accordance with established quality requirements.
  • Ensure pump station facilities are designed in compliance with applicable regulations, industry standards, corporate specifications, and engineering best practices.
  • Design electrical systems, components, and interconnections for pump station facilities and supporting infrastructure.
  • Review, evaluate, and approve engineering design deliverables, including drawings, technical reports, calculations, specifications, and material listing sheets.
  • Participate in multidisciplinary design review meetings with engineering consultants, Project Managers, Operations personnel, and Construction teams to review project scope, design intent, expected performance, and constructability considerations.
  • Review vendor quotations and technical submissions; conduct technical evaluations and provide recommendations based on technical suitability, cost, quality, and delivery requirements.
  • Support the selection and procurement of equipment and materials, including pumps, motors, generators, vessels, buildings, piping systems, valves, fittings, and associated electrical equipment.
  • Identify, document, and communicate lessons learned, quality incidents, and opportunities for continuous improvement across assigned projects.
  • Collaborate with internal stakeholders to ensure operational, maintenance, safety, and reliability requirements are incorporated into project designs.
  • Provide technical support during procurement, construction, commissioning, and project start-up activities.
  • Support departmental initiatives and contribute to continuous improvement, standardization, and operational excellence efforts as required.
